ci: re-pin Gadfly to a reusable workflow whose image still exists
Build image / build-and-push (push) Successful in 15s

The pinned gadfly commit (c9dab69) hard-coded the reviewer image
gadfly:sha-b37cd09, which has since been pruned from the registry, so every
review on a new PR failed in one second at "manifest unknown" (#124's did).
gadfly's current main (8adeeea) runs the reviewer as a job container whose tag
resolves at run time — reviewer_tag input → GADFLY_REVIEWER_TAG var → a baked
fallback (sha-b850e35, verified present) — so a retired tag can't strand the
consumer stubs again. Inputs and secrets are a superset of what this stub
forwards.

# 8adeeea resolves the reviewer image tag at RUN time (reviewer_tag input →
# the owner's GADFLY_REVIEWER_TAG var → a baked fallback that exists in the
# registry), so a retired image tag can't strand this stub again: the previous
# pin (c9dab69) hard-coded gadfly:sha-b37cd09, which had been pruned from the
# registry by 2026-08-22 and every review died at "manifest unknown".
uses: steve/gadfly/.gitea/workflows/review-reusable.yml@8adeeeabe0738a797a1bdfc42c5176ea8ee627e4
# Least privilege: forward only the review secrets (not `secrets: inherit`,
# which would expose every repo secret). GITEA_TOKEN is the automatic token.
